Transaction 34ebbef6817cdca0457f5e1457574795bdbe9646d0d445c7cfa506e487cca104
1 Input
2 Outputs
- 34ebbef6817cdca0457f5e1457574795bdbe9646d0d445c7cfa506e487cca104:0
- 34ebbef6817cdca0457f5e1457574795bdbe9646d0d445c7cfa506e487cca104:1
value 1196900
address 3Bvyts3Ltva1eK65ZUyEaBgZFR2nfJZtFp
value 20082448
address 17RLYhZ5fgdN1gwxvtMkzQhN6roLTpevMG